“Dick Tracy and the Kincaid Problem”

In "Dick Tracy and the Kincaid Problem," Dick Tracy and Sam catch a break in a cold case when the Plenty family’s new bathroom reveals hidden clues tied to a murder that’s haunted Kincaid Plenty for years. Written and drawn by Chester Gould, this 1955 installment blends sharp detective work with the signature visual flair of the era, while Joe Simon’s cover captures the tension with a striking, noir-inspired image.

Full plot ⚠ may contain spoilers

▸ Reveal full plot — may contain spoilers

The Plenty family begins enjoying their new bathroom as Tracy and Sam work to piece together the clues that will help them solve a years-old murder and clear Kincaid Plenty of criminal charges.
